Beleaguered bosses of Standard Life face their toughest test winning the trust of disillusioned savers to back demutualisation. And they were confronted with a withering protest last week.
'We can never believe anything you say ever again,' chief executive Sandy Crombie was told by Steve Huxham of internet-based lobby group the Investors' Association.See the full content of this document
